Here is a description of the subject area of this SIG: The Metrics & Evaluation Special Interest Group (ME SIG) enables MCN members to exchange research (results and methodology) and share questions regarding all manner of quantitative and qualitative evaluation of online museum content. Areas of particular interest are user feedback analysis, server log analysis, and user consultation and participation. The ME SIG endeavors to develop best practices and further the knowledge and expertise of participants as a result of pooling our experience.
